“Lubag”, X-Linked Dystonia Parkinsonism: What It Was, What It Is and What Can Be Hope For

Edda Brenda S. Yerro | Glenda S Paguntalan | Prency D. Yerro

 

Abstract:

The paper looks into literatures related to dystonia or sex-linked dystonia-parkinsonism. It tries to put into perspective the different aspects of the disorder; from the beliefs of those who are within the immediate vicinity of the afflicted person, the observed symptoms, explanations on how one gets afflicted to the latest medical and available pharmaceutical therapy. It aims to shine some light on the struggle of the affected person and their family, not just from dealing with the disease physically and medically but also from the emotional stress brought about by the rumors of their unaware neighbors and even relatives. Furthermore, it aspires to share knowledge to elevate consciousness among those who are concerned and offer even a little hope to those who are affected. To let them know that efforts are being done on their behalf; that there are organizations they can approach committed to helping them. Most importantly, some people have dedicated their lives studying the disease not just to alleviate their symptoms but to help improve their quality of life.
